Oracle 数据库代码编写遵循五个关键步骤:选择编程语言(PL/SQL、Java 或 SQL)连接到数据库编写 PL/SQL 代码(存储过程、函数、触发器、包)使用 SQL 语句与数据库交互(查询、更新、管理数据)通过 EXCEPTION 块处理错误
Oracle 代码编写指南
在 Oracle 数据库中编写代码需要遵循特定的规则和语法。本指南概述了 Oracle 代码编写的关键步骤和最佳实践。
步骤 1:选择编程语言
Oracle 支持多种编程语言,包括 PL/SQL、Java 和 SQL。根据您的特定需求选择合适的语言。
步骤 2:连接到数据库
使用 SQL*Plus、JDBC 或其他连接机制与 Oracle 数据库建立连接。
步骤 3:编写 PL/SQL 代码
PL/SQL 是 Oracle 的内置编程语言,用于编写存储过程、函数、触发器和包。
- 存储过程: 一组PL/SQL语句,执行特定任务。
- 函数: 返回值的PL/SQL语句。
- 触发器: 在特定事件发生时执行的PL/SQL代码块。
- 包: 将相关 PL/SQL 对象(例如,变量、常量、过程)分组在一起。
步骤 4:使用 SQL
SQL 用于查询、更新和管理数据。Oracle 代码可以使用 SQL 语句与数据库交互。
- SELECT: 从表中检索数据。
- INSERT: 向表中插入数据。
- UPDATE: 更新表中现有数据。
- DELETE: 从表中删除数据。
步骤 5:处理错误
使用 EXCEPTION 块处理错误和异常情况。
- BEGIN: 错误处理块的开始。
- EXCEPTION: 特定错误类型的处理程序。
- WHEN: 发生特定错误时的处理代码。
- END;: 错误处理块的结束。
最佳实践
- 遵循命名约定: 使用有意义的名称来标识变量、表和函数。
- 使用适当的数据类型: 选择与数据值范围和精度匹配的数据类型。
- 优化代码: 使用索引、缓存和批处理等技术提高性能。
- 进行测试: 彻底测试您的代码以确保其正确性和健壮性。
- 注释代码: 添加注释以解释代码的逻辑和意图。
以上是oracle怎么写代码的详细内容。更多信息请关注PHP中文网其他相关文章!

Oracle软件通过数据库管理、ERP、CRM和数据分析功能简化业务流程。1)OracleERPCloud自动化财务、人力资源等流程;2)OracleCXCloud管理客户互动,提供个性化服务;3)OracleAnalyticsCloud支持数据分析和决策。

Oracle的软件套件包括数据库管理、ERP、CRM等,帮助企业优化运营、提高效率、降低成本。1.OracleDatabase管理数据,2.OracleERPCloud处理财务、人力资源和供应链,3.使用OracleSCMCloud优化供应链管理,4.通过API和集成工具确保数据流动和一致性。

MySQL和Oracle的主要区别在于许可证、功能和优势。1.许可证:MySQL提供GPL许可证,免费使用,Oracle采用专有许可证,价格昂贵。2.功能:MySQL功能简单,适合Web应用和中小型企业,Oracle功能强大,适合大规模数据和复杂业务。3.优势:MySQL开源免费,适合初创公司,Oracle性能可靠,适合大型企业。

MySQL和Oracle在性能、成本和使用场景上有显着差异。 1)性能:Oracle在复杂查询和高并发环境下表现更好。 2)成本:MySQL开源,成本低,适合中小型项目;Oracle商业化,成本高,适用于大型企业。 3)使用场景:MySQL适用于Web应用和中小型企业,Oracle适合复杂的企业级应用。选择时需根据具体需求权衡。

Oracle软件可以通过多种方法提升性能。1)优化SQL查询,减少数据传输量;2)适当管理索引,平衡查询速度和维护成本;3)合理配置内存,优化SGA和PGA;4)减少I/O操作,使用合适的存储设备。

Oracle在企业软件和云计算领域如此重要是因为其全面的解决方案和强大的技术支持。1)Oracle提供从数据库管理到ERP的广泛产品线,2)其云计算服务如OracleCloudPlatform和Infrastructure帮助企业实现数字化转型,3)Oracle数据库的稳定性和性能以及云服务的无缝集成提升了企业效率。

MySQL和Oracle各有优劣,选择时需综合考虑:1.MySQL适合轻量级、易用需求,适用于Web应用和中小型企业;2.Oracle适合功能强大、可靠性高需求,适用于大型企业和复杂业务系统。

MySQL采用GPL和商业许可,适合小型和开源项目;Oracle采用商业许可,适合需要高性能的企业。MySQL的GPL许可免费,商业许可需付费;Oracle许可费用按处理器或用户计算,成本较高。


热AI工具

Undresser.AI Undress
人工智能驱动的应用程序,用于创建逼真的裸体照片

AI Clothes Remover
用于从照片中去除衣服的在线人工智能工具。

Undress AI Tool
免费脱衣服图片

Clothoff.io
AI脱衣机

Video Face Swap
使用我们完全免费的人工智能换脸工具轻松在任何视频中换脸!

热门文章

热工具

EditPlus 中文破解版
体积小,语法高亮,不支持代码提示功能

PhpStorm Mac 版本
最新(2018.2.1 )专业的PHP集成开发工具

SublimeText3 Linux新版
SublimeText3 Linux最新版

WebStorm Mac版
好用的JavaScript开发工具

ZendStudio 13.5.1 Mac
功能强大的PHP集成开发环境